Hudson Valley Man Sentenced To Prison For Sex With Child Under 13
A Hudson Valley man has been sentenced to state prison for sexual conduct against a child under the age of 13.
Orange County resident Eduardo Martinez-Rojas, age 30, of Highland Mills, a hamlet of Woodbury, was sentenced on Monday, April 8 to 15 years in prison and 10 years of post-release supervision, according to Orange County District Attorney David Hoovler.
Martinez-Rojas, who will also be registered as a sexual offender, admitted that he engaged in two or more acts of sexual intercourse, oral sex, and anal sex with a child under the age of 13, Hoovler said.

Total Solar Eclipse NY Travel Advisory: Arrive Early, Plan On Staying Late, Hochul Says
In preparation for a high volume of traffic and visitors for the total solar eclipse on Monday, April 8, New York Gov. Kathy Hochul is advising travelers to arrive to their destinations early and plan on staying late.
In addition, Hochul said on Sunday, April 7, travelers should allow for extra time, monitor the weather forecast before getting on the road, and pack plenty of water and snacks for the trip.
Additionally, drivers should never pull over on the side of the road to view the eclipse to ensure first responders can get by in an emergency.
